Just visited Carlos & Mickey's for the first time tonight, much to the surprise of my buddy Ruby, who made it seem like this place was so well established that I would have visited it a lost when I lived in El Paso.  Nope, I was a C&M first-timer.

The food is very good!  I've had a mad craving for some queso fundido for a few weeks now, so I had to go for it, and it was well worth it, half-cheese, half-chorizo and green chiles, 100% heaven!  My entree had an enchilada, carnitas, chile relleno, and 2 tacos, all of them terrific.  Capped off the meal with some top notch flan, highly recommend it!  I don't drink, but I hear they have some killer margaritas here, and they certainly look yummy :)  

The atmosphere is very festive and vibrant, but the only thing keeping me from granting that elusive 5th star was the volume of the music.  Listen, I love live mariachi as much as anyone else, but good lord they are loud, like you can't carry a conversation at all loud!  I know its a big part of the atmosphere, but there's gotta be a way to either not play as loud, or not play as often.

Lets give them what they deserve, which is really 2.5 stars because this place is as average as they come. I have not been here for a couple of years as that was the last time I was able to make it to El Paso to visit my family. Hopefully, I won't have to go back on my upcoming trip there this week, but you never know what people will want to do when everyone gets together. I grew up in NY, but have lived in San Diego for the past six years. I have also been exposed to Mexican food my whole life and have visited areas of Mexico. I have had some amazing homemade Mexican food while in El Paso, and even the orders of tamales that my family tends to pick up from others have been very good. Carlos and Mickey's though, is just another Americanized, sit-down, Tex-Mex type of place that they have all over the country. This one, like some of the ones in SD, tends to have a more authentic menu on paper anyway, but doesn't really deliver in the kitchen.
     We tend to order the chile con queso as an appetizer, which I thought was the best thing I tried. I ordered the Carnitas one time, which was a terrible disappointment. They were dry and fried crispy, which I understand is the way that some people make them, but I specifically tried to find out if they would be this type. I prefer the slow cooked, tender moist flavorful carnitas that I get back in SD. These were hard and crispy, nothing enjoyable about them. I have tried the fish, which was decent, but my Tia really seemed to enjoy. Unfortunately, it has been a while, so I don't remember all of the dishes, but I hope to not return, so I probably will never remember them. It says a lot that I can't remember them anyway.
     The best things here are probably the margaritas, which i think are the real draw. The fam loves to come and drink the big ones and get nice and toasty. That's why this place is still fun. But overall, I have no desire to go to this place again.
